Traveling from Flagstaff to Phoenix Airport: Your Complete Shuttle Guide

When you need a reliable flagstaff to phoenix airport shuttle, the most convenient option is a scheduled shared‑ride service operated by Groome Transportation. With more than 90 years of experience, their flagstaff‑based team provides a stress‑free link between the northern Arizona mountain town and Phoenix Sky Harbor International Airport (PHX). The route follows Interstate 17 southward, a scenic 145‑mile corridor that cuts through the Coconino National Forest, past the Mogollon Rim, and into the Sonoran Desert. Whether you’re heading to a connecting flight, a business meeting, or a vacation in the Valley of the Sun, understanding the shuttle’s features, booking process, and travel tips will help you arrive on time and in comfort.

Route Overview and Key Landmarks

The shuttle departs from two primary Flagstaff locations:

  • Flagstaff Groome Office – 2646 E. Route 66, Flagstaff, AZ 86004. The office is just minutes from historic downtown Flagstaff and Northern Arizona University.
  • Flagstaff Amtrak Station – 1 E. Route 66, Flagstaff, AZ 86001. Passengers should wait in the parking lot on the San Francisco Street side of the station, at least 15 minutes before the scheduled departure.

After leaving Flagstaff, the vehicle travels south on I‑17, passing notable sites such as Sunset Crater Volcano National Monument, the town of Camp Verde, and the Montezuma Castle National Monument area before reaching the Phoenix metropolitan area. The final drop‑off point is the South Parking Lot near N Metro Pkwy & N 29th Ave at Phoenix Sky Harbor International Airport, 3400 E. Sky Harbor Blvd, Phoenix, AZ 85034. This location is clearly marked and provides easy access to all terminals, especially Terminal 4, which handles the majority of domestic flights.

Estimated Travel Time

Under normal traffic conditions, the flagstaff to phoenix airport shuttle takes approximately 2½ to 3 hours. During peak travel periods—typically early morning or late afternoon on weekdays—the journey can extend to 3½ hours because of heavier traffic on I‑17 and within the Phoenix metro area. The shuttle driver monitors real‑time traffic updates and can adjust the route if needed, ensuring passengers reach the airport with minimal delay.

Luggage, Accessibility, and Special Needs

Groome’s shuttle fleet accommodates standard luggage allowances: one checked suitcase per passenger plus a personal item. Extra bags can often be arranged, but it’s best to notify the office when booking to ensure space. All vehicles are equipped with climate control and free Wi‑Fi (where signal permits), making the ride productive or relaxing.

Accessibility is a priority. Wheelchair‑accessible units are available; please indicate any mobility device requirements when you make your reservation. Child safety seats are provided at no extra charge for children under 8 years old, and the driver will assist with installing them. Service animals are welcome on all vehicles.
